The penetration of ampicillin molecule into the beta-cyclodextrin cavity in aqueous solution is studied by (1) H NMR, 2D COSY and ROESY spectroscopy. Obtained data suggest that the phenyl moiety of ampicillin is included inside the hydrophobic cavity of beta-cyclodextrin molecule in the solution, and the mode and depth of this inclusion is confirmed on the basis of 2D ROESY spectral data.
